Lets compare vitamin content per 5 ounces of Boiled California Red Kidney Beans vs Papayas:
- 5 ounces of Boiled California Red Kidney Beans have 5.6 times more Vitamin B1, 2.3 times more Vitamin B2, 1.5 times more Vitamin B3, 2.7 times more Vitamin B6 and 2 times more Vitamin B9 than Papayas.
- While 5 oz of Raw Papayas contain more Vitamin A and 50.8 times more Vitamin C than Boiled California Red Kidney Beans.
- Both Boiled California Red Kidney Beans and Papayas provide similar amounts of Vitamin B5 per five ounces.
- 5 ounces of Boiled California Red Kidney Beans have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A and Vitamin C
- 5 ounces of Papayas have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B1
- Both Boiled California Red Kidney Beans as well as Raw Papayas have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in five ounces.
Comparing minerals per 5 ounces for Boiled California Red Kidney Beans vs Papayas:
- 5 ounces of Boiled California Red Kidney Beans have 3.3 times more Calcium, 6.4 times more Copper, 11.9 times more Iron, 2.3 times more Magnesium, 8 times more Manganese, 13.7 times more Phosphorus, 2.3 times more Potassium, 2 times more Selenium and 10.8 times more Zinc than Papayas.
- While 5 oz of Raw Papayas contain 1.3 times more Water than Boiled California Red Kidney Beans.
- 5 ounces of Papayas lack sufficient amounts of Manganese, Phosphorus, Selenium and Zinc
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 5 ounces:
- 5 ounces of Boiled California Red Kidney Beans have 2.9 times more Energy, 2.1 times more Carbohydrate, 5.5 times more Fiber and 19.4 times more Protein than Papayas.
- While 5 oz of Raw Papayas contain 1.5 times more Omega 3 than Boiled California Red Kidney Beans.
- 5 ounces of Papayas provide inadequate amounts of Energy and Protein
- Both Boiled California Red Kidney Beans as well as Raw Papayas provide inadequate amounts of Omega 6 in five ounces.
